British Motor Museum

For those kids who love all things cars, you need to zoom down to this Gaydon Motor Museum and immerse yourself in motoring history.

Discover classic British cars and their development to the cars we know today! Like the Land Rover and Jaguar models – there’s even vintage models you can take a peek at. Wander around a museum with over a million objects on display, and feast your eyes on royal cars, sports cars and even those in iconic films! With costumed characters dotted around the British Motor Museum, you’ll be able to ask them all your pressing questions about cars from the past and cars of today!

There are plenty of family-friendly activities to get involved in, too. Like themed trails, gaming screens, activity sheets and even getting behind the wheel of a classic car!

Head outside for more adventure ontop of a galleon ship in the playground!

National Space Centre, Leicester

Get ready for lift off! Put on your helmet to board the iconic 42m high rocket tower, tour the six interactive galleries and embark on a journey. Browse through spacesuits of the past as you piece together man’s amazing voyage into the unknown… Become a trainee astronaut at the Tranquillity Base, have a go at charting planets and see what you can discover as you peer through the telescope. By the end of the day, you’ll feel well-equipped to explore the universe! 

All at the National Space Centre!

Imperial War Museum North, Manchester

If you’ve ever wondered whether there’s any museums in Manchester, then you’ve come to the right place! Only at the Imperial War Museum can you discover how war shapes lives through revealing powerful stories.

Read a soldier’s last letter home and examine objects like the twisted steel of the World Trade Centre. Explore a First World War trench, discover what life would have been like for an evacuee, escape from a prisoner of war camp through a tunnel, and more at this museum full of fascinating exhibitions.

The Natural History Museum, London

Care to visit the landmark of all museums? The Natural History Museum is home to over 80 million amazing plants, animals, fossils, rocks and minerals. Begin your dive into it all by paying a visit to their star resident: an enormous, animatronic T-Rex! Families can then take a free, behind-the-scenes tour and meet a brilliantly gross and totally fascinating giant squid.

Black Country Living Museum, Dudley

Travel back in time today, at the Black Country Living Museum! Be transported back to the boom of the industrial revolution, 300 years ago. You may recognise it from your TV screens as it is the occasional set for Peaky Blinders! Walk in the shoes of an 18th-century coal miner or take the bus around the museum, passing old shops and candlelit pubs.

Just remember before you leave: No Black Country visit is complete without a traditional English fish & chips or a stop at the sweet shop. Get those coppers ready!

The Dinosaur Museum, Dorset

At the award-winning Dinosaur Museum, it’s all about having a roaring good time! It’s uniqueness comes from the fact it is the only British museum devoted solely to dinos with skeletons, life-size reconstructions and a few scaly surprises… Listen out for the Triceratops, meet a Stegosaurus and smell the breath of a T-Rex! With so many cool & interactive games too, it’s a sure winner among family days out.

National Roman Legion Museum, Newport

Ever wondered what a Roman soldier’s bedroom looked like 2,000 years ago? Wonder no more! At the National Roman Legion Museum you can step back in time and enter a Roman’s bedroom, check out a Roman child’s teeth and inspect a real life soldier’s helmet… Don’t forget to see the Fortress Baths, Amphitheatre and Barracks too, they are a must see! This museum is one of the best museums for kids, for sure.

Bank of England Museum, London

There’s something for everyone at the Bank of England Museum, with attractions including activity sheets for children of all ages, banknote jigsaws, a roller ball game, touch screens and the opportunity for some safe cracking! Take control of a virtual hot air balloon to learn about inflation or handle a real gold bar – it’s the only place in the UK where you can do that!

Grant Zoology Museum, London

Curious about animal anatomy? This quirky museum shows you the skeletons and preservations of animals & minibeasts all great, small & extinct. Keep an eye out for the Dodo bones, Anaconda skeleton, and the Brain Collection… check out the 14,000 different specimens of insects and don’t forget to visit the remains of the extinct Tasmanian Tiger.

It is without a doubt one of the best museums for kids who are fascinated by animals, nature and life itself.

Royal Air Force Museum London

Visit the Museum’s Battle of Britain Hall and get up close a personal to aircraft that flew in the Battle itself. Be amazed by the 5m high statue of Sir Keith Park and take in our free emotive sound and light show ‘Our Finest Hour’ about ‘The Few’ which runs daily from 11:00 to 17:00 in the Hall. Listen to Winston Churchill’s iconic Battle of Britain speech to the nation from his office in No.10 Downing Street. This day out is truly an insightful and moving one.
